About Port of Angarsk
Also known as: Protoka Elovaja, Protoka Yelovaya, Протока Еловая
Angarsk is a canal port located on the Kitoy River in Irkutsk Oblast, Russia. Established in 1948, it functions as a waterway hub within the region.
Background
Angarsk is a city and the administrative center of Angarsky District of Irkutsk Oblast, Russia, located on the Kitoy River, 51 kilometers (32 mi) from Irkutsk, the administrative center of the oblast. Population: 221,296 (2021 census); 233,567 (2010 census); 247,118 (2002 census); 265,835 (1989 Soviet census).Current Conditions
